About Us

We are an Aerospace & Defense company based out of Bangalore and Delhi NCR. We design and develop next generation mission technologies (NGMT) to provide an unparalleled advantage to the Indian Armed Forces in the battlefields of tomorrow. Our current product development portfolio includes a solar-powered stratospheric aircraft, the high altitude pseudo satellite (HAPS) , air/ ground-launched smart autonomous unmanned systems, AR/VR systems and Air Combat Simulators.

Job Summary

We are seeking a highly skilled and motivated Flight Controls Engineer to join us for the development of flight controls for an aeroelastic aircraft. The ideal candidate will be responsible for the design, development, and testing of flight control systems for unmanned aerial vehicles. This role involves working closely with cross-functional teams to ensure the successful integration and performance of UAV control systems.

Key Responsibilities
Design and Development
  • Design and optimize the stability and controllability to meet safety and mission requirements
  • Develop and implement advanced flight control algorithms and systems for UAVs.
  • Design and optimize control loops for stability, performance, and robustness.
  • Collaborate with hardware and software teams to integrate control systems with UAV platforms.
  • Establish multiloop flight control algorithms for aeroelastic aircraft.
  • Implement guidance and control in MATLAB/ SIMULINK and C++
  • Establish sub-system-level hardware requirements and validate them experimentally.
  • Conduct safety analysis using STPA, FHA, FMEA and FTA.
  • Perform integrated system checks on iron bird and subscale platforms
Testing and Validation
  • Conduct simulation and hardware-in-the-loop (HIL) testing to validate control system performance.
  • Perform flight testing and data analysis to refine and improve control algorithms.
  • Troubleshoot and resolve issues related to flight control systems.
  • Certification and Compliance:
  • Ensure flight control systems meet relevant certification requirements, including DO-178C standards.
  • Prepare documentation and artifacts required for certification processes.
  • Work with regulatory bodies to achieve necessary certifications for UAV systems.
